Project Overview

The Internet Service Provider (I.S.P) project encompasses the establishment and operation of high-speed internet connectivity services tailored for various sectors including hotels, hospitals, schools, colleges, medical colleges, entertainment clubs, warehousing, and real estate projects. The primary goal is to facilitate seamless internet access to these institutions, improving their operational efficiency and enhancing the experience of their patrons. I.S.Ps play a crucial role in supporting the digital ecosystem by providing essential internet services, ranging from basic broadband solutions to advanced fiber optic technology, enabling users to access online resources, cloud applications, and digital communications. The integration of high-speed internet in educational institutions, healthcare facilities, and hospitality sectors has become indispensable, as it allows for better information sharing, remote functionalities, and connectivity with the outside world. Furthermore, the project highlights the importance of customer support, service reliability, and continuous infrastructure development to meet the growing demands. The I.S.P project will employ cutting-edge technology to ensure scalable and secured internet services while catering to the specific needs of each industry segment it serves.

SWOT Analysis

Strengths

  • Established brand presence in the local market.
  • Diverse range of service offerings tailored to specific sectors.
  • Strong technical expertise and customer support.
  • Ability to leverage modern technology for service delivery.

Weaknesses

  • High initial investment and infrastructure costs.
  • Dependence on third-party telecom infrastructure in some regions.
  • Potentially limited market share in competitive areas.
  • Challenges in maintaining service quality during peak times.

Opportunities

  • Increasing internet penetration rate in developing regions.
  • Growing trend of digitalization in industries.
  • Potential partnerships with tech companies for advanced solutions.
  • Expansion into e-learning and telehealth sectors.

Threats

  • Intense competition from existing and new service providers.
  • Rapidly changing technology landscape requiring constant adaptation.
  • Regulatory challenges and compliance requirements.
  • Cybersecurity threats impacting customer trust and service reliability.

Raw Materials Required

  • Fiber optic cables
  • Networking hardware (routers, switches)
  • Server infrastructure
  • Customer premises equipment (CPE)
  • Office equipment for support and administration
